A mobile device includes an application program that is capable of determining its location and a bearing direction of travel. Further, the application program is associated with a service that operates a back end server that the application program can contact to receive definitions of local geofenced regions, including regions over roadways that indicate the proper bearing direction of traffic for vehicles in those defined regions. The application program monitors the location of the device, which is also the location of a vehicle in which the device is traveling, and compares it with geofenced regions. When the vehicle is within a geofenced region having a traffic direction indication, the application program compares the present bearing direction with that indicated for the geofenced region. Then the comparison indicates the vehicle in the wrong direction, the application program causes the mobile device to emit one or more alerts to indicate to an operator of the vehicle that the vehicle is traveling in the wrong direction for that traffic lane.
